Researcher Austin Kocher: Over 600,000 People Booked Into ICE Detention Since Trump II Began

confirmed Importance 7/10 ~2 min read 1 source 2 actors

Independent researcher Austin Kocher — the primary quantitative beat source tracking ICE detention data — published an analysis July 28, 2026 documenting that ICE has booked over 600,000 people into detention facilities since Trump took office in January 2025, based on data ICE released the prior week. The 600K figure is a bookings count: everyone processed through the detention intake pipeline, which is a distinct and larger metric than the deportation count tracked separately (compare 2026-07-23–ice-nears-600k-deportations-july-arrest-record, which approaches the same round number but measures a different stage of the pipeline — the near-simultaneous convergence of two different 600K metrics is itself notable and should not be conflated in downstream reporting).

The bookings figure sits against a backdrop of a data blackout: ICE has provided reduced public reporting since April 2026 (2026-07-21–ice-data-blackout-since-april-2026) and eliminated a detention-reporting mandate that had been catching a 16% population undercount (2026-07-27–ice-detention-reporting-mandate-eliminated-16-percent-undercount). Kocher’s independent dataset is one of the few remaining ways to track system-wide throughput absent official disclosure.
